Transaction e34f71e9eb62a779edde7e890f796c1a86172e53b7f384942475a9d1cfccb5e2

600 Input
1 Outputs
  • e34f71e9eb62a779edde7e890f796c1a86172e53b7f384942475a9d1cfccb5e2:0
  • value  1596211318
    address  bc1qgzyukqpl8esvgkfh8n9kskhmuspdqh606xkqts